Job description

About Us:

   

The people of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center (MSK) are united by a singular mission: ending cancer for life. Our specialized care teams provide personalized, compassionate, expert care to patients of all ages. Informed by basic research done at our Sloan Kettering Institute, scientists across MSK collaborate to conduct innovative translational and clinical research that is driving a revolution in our understanding of cancer as a disease and improving the ability to prevent, diagnose, and treat it. MSK is dedicated to training the next generation of scientists and clinicians, who go on to pursue our mission at MSK and around the globe.

 

We are: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center for our main hospital location in Manhattan is seeking Ultrasound Technologists.

Role Overview:

  • Under the administrative direction of the Radiology Manager /Ultrasound Supervisor and under the clinical guidance of the General/Interventional /Vascular Radiologists, performs a variety of diagnostic ultrasound procedures while applying his/her technical ability independently.
  • Interacts and collaborates in a positive way with all other staff members at MSKCC.

Qualifications:

  • High school diploma. Graduation from an approved Commission on Accreditation of Allied Health Education Programs (CAAHEP) School of Ultrasound is required.
  • RVT & RDMS in Abdomen required. Experience includes general imaging, biopsies and specialized vascular procedures.
  • Minimum of 2-3 years relevant experience.

Additional Information:

  • Shift: 3 days a week - Friday, Sunday, Monday.
  • Training will be 9AM-5PM, 5 days a week. Once training is complete, you will be moved to a 3 day workweek.
